Review of Land Fires and Smoke Haze Situation for Second Fortnight of February 2019

1.1 The prolonged dry conditions in the northern ASEAN region contributed to the widespread smoke haze that continued enveloping most parts of the Mekong sub-region. Dense smoke haze was observed over parts of Cambodia, Lao PDR and Thailand during the first half of February 2019. There were also occurrences of transboundary haze as some smoke haze was blown towards Lao PDR and Viet Nam from the neighbouring countries during this period.

1.2 In the southern ASEAN region, localised smoke plumes were observed from isolated hotspots in Riau, Sumatra and in Johor, Peninsular Malaysia. Otherwise, hotspot activities remained generally subdued.
